Elon Musk's Twitter bid puts a $5 billion-a-year advertising business into the hands of someone who has publicly questioned the platform's advertising business model and whose current company—Tesla—buys no advertising

Elon Musk struck a deal on Monday to buy Twitter for about $44 billion, moving the world’s richest man a step closer to taking control of the social-media platform. Photo: Ryan Lash/TED Conferences, LLC/AFP via Getty ImagesWall Street has long known that it is better to play with other people’s money. But in the case of Elon Musk, other people’s money may limit just how much playing he can do with Twitter .
